The garage occupancy feed for the Brindlewood campus arrives over a message queue every thirty seconds, one record per level, published by the Stallgrid edge boxes. Counts can briefly go negative when a sensor double-fires on exit; the ingest job clamps these to zero and flags the interval. If the feed stalls for more than five minutes, the dashboard falls back to the last known snapshot. Sensor mappings, queue names, and the replay procedure are documented on the internal page below.

runbook for tahog-kadug: https://gitlab.qirvanworks.corp/projects/pages/view/b139298aed28

**Handover — shared lab, Wrenfield Level 3**

Heads up for tonight: we're now sharing the Level 3 lab with the Quillon team, so don't be surprised if their kit is on the left benches. Leave their stuff alone and keep our samples in the marked fridge. They lock up around 11pm; after that it's on us. The lab door takes the code below.

turnstile pass: bdg-QZV-3

Environments: Emberline Admin Dashboard (Dark Mode)

The Emberline admin dashboard ships dark-mode support in three environments: dev, staging, and production. Theme tokens are compiled per environment; staging mirrors production except for the preview flag, which lets testers toggle dark mode per session. Production enables it for all tenants at the next release. Rollbacks revert the theme bundle only, not user preferences. The environment-specific settings the release build reads are listed below.

settings of yageg-yahap:
[gorael]
team = olieth
access_code = ac_941d74
owner = brieth.aldiel
host = gorael.tolvaqio.internal
port = 6379
peer = briwyn.urlaqtech.internal
salt = 116e6622
pin = 1957

- [ ] **Step 7: Breaker override escrow.** After sealing the signing keys for the Tallgrove upstream API circuit breaker, confirm the support team can force the breaker open during a full outage. The override bundle lives in the sealed escrow drawer and is useless without its unlock phrase. Two ceremony witnesses must initial this step before proceeding. The escrow bundle is decrypted with the recovery passphrase that follows.

vault phrase of kahip-kahop = holath-quenmir